these came with my s20 5g. they sound good but you have to have the volume up to at least half if not more to actually hear the music. tried them on a plane trip and could barely hear my music with them all the way up. can't charge phone while using these earphones as only charging port is taken.
also after 2 hours of using these while in the airport waiting for flight my ears began hurting and were sore for rest of day. my 2 pairs of klipsch 3.5mm in-ears are very comfortable and i can wear them all day with zero discomfort. least i didn't pay for these.
real pain to have to have another dongle to carry around. at least add another usb-c port to the phone to allow charging and listening to music at the same time.

I prefer the one with 3.5 mm jack.
on July 27, 2020
Posted by: ADOLPHE SOME
i have both versions, one with the 3.5 mm audio jack came with my s10+ last year and this one with usb-c. i like the one with 3.5 mm jack because i accidentally put it multiple times in my washer and dryer and it still sounds great and i can listen to music with it and charge my phone using a power bank while on the bus or walking. this one with usb-c jack sounded better but not only the audio and mic didn't sound loud(100% of its volume sounded like 50% of the one with the 3.5 mm jack), it also had less bass and stopped working the very 1st time i accidentally washed it. don't buy this one if you have hearing problems. the 5 stars i gave are for the previous version with the 3.5 mm jack, not the current one.
